Hera reaches the asteroid humans nudged
Hera is the detective arriving after the crash test. It measures what changed so future asteroid-deflection plans can be based on evidence.

Why show them
Hera is expected to meet Didymos and its moon Dimorphos, then study the result of NASA’s 2022 DART impact—the first test of changing an asteroid’s motion.
Look for
Treat the first pictures as clues, not proof by themselves. Confirmation should combine navigation data, images, and ESA’s statement that rendezvous was achieved.
